Al-Burhan inspects those affected by torrential rains in Tokar locality

Head of the Transitional Sovereignty Council, Commander-in-Chief of the Sudanese Armed Forces, 1st Lieutenant-General Abdul Fattah Al-Burhan, inspected the areas affected by the floods and rains in Tokar locality, accompanied by the governor of the Red Sea State, Lieutenant-General Mustafa Mohamed Nour.
Al-Burhan and his accompanying delegation insoected the extent of the damage and losses suffered by the local citizens.
His Excellency also inspected the roads, bridges and bridges that were affected by torrential rains and floods in the region, pointing to the state’s commitment and support to those affected by torrential rains,
“We will provide all the assistance and support necessary to them to alleviate their suffering and harness all state agencies to help those affected to overcome this ordeal.” Al-Burhan affirmed
He offered sincere condolences to the families of the victims, wishing a speedy recovery to the injured.
